whats the difference between covalent and ionic bonds

Respuesta :

DarkDemotapes
DarkDemotapes DarkDemotapes
  • 12-05-2020

Answer:

An ionic bond essentially donates an electron to the other atom participating in the bond, while electrons in a covalent bond are shared equally between the atoms. The only pure covalent bonds occur between identical atoms. ... Ionic bonds form between a metal and a nonmetal. Covalent bonds form between two nonmetals.
